Insomnia

Insomnia is a sleep disorder characterized by difficulty falling asleep, difficulty staying asleep, or waking up too early. Insomnia can cause a wide range of physical and mental health problems and can significantly impair a person's quality of life. Effective treatments are available to help people with insomnia sleep better and improve their overall health.
